In some pages (such as http://www.scenespot.org), it seems as though the text overlaps some links. It even seems to overlap the tables as well. I havn't observed it on all pages (for example, it's flawless on bugzilla). Resizing the window does decrease the amount of overlap, but even at 1280x1020, I still cannot completely eliminate it.
are you using XFree86 4.0.x with truetype fonts? Could you attach a screenshot of what you see?
FYI (should've posted this with the screenshot): I'm using Mozilla version 2001043014. My machine: Mandrake Linux (version 8.0) XFree86 4.0.x KDE desktop enviornment I'm not exactly sure, but I believe I am in fact using true type fonts through the xfont server (default configuration from Mandrake). About the site (it helps that I coded it): The site calls for an Ariel font. Other sites that I have seen with this problem also call for specific fonts.
Yep. It's the XFree 4.0.x + truetype problem.... *** This bug has been marked as a duplicate of 59915 ***
